# generalized schur decomposition

Hello, I've been translating some matlab code to python/scipy, and in matlab there's a function called qz that takes two matrices as arguments and returns their general schur decomposition. Uses the QZ algorithm, also known as the generalized Schur decomposition. Is it correct that the necessary and sufficient condition for existence of Schur decomposition and those for Jordan (normal form) decomposition are the same? Usage The periodic Schur decomposition. Following a problem proposed in , we consider the monochromatic solutions to . Generalized eigenvalues and eigenvectors use QZ decomposition (generalized Schur decomposition). In scipy, I found scipy.linalg.schur which only does the decomposition â¦ It is shown that generalized Schur functions have strong radial limit values almost everywhere on the unit circle. The generalized Schur (QZ) by asmae » Thu May 23, 2013 3:00 pm . Generalized Schur decomposition: Standard functions. Algorithms and applications. For example, see NETLIB zgees documentation, or a documentation for any other BLAS/LAPACK library implementation. [3] The generalized eigenvalues that solve the generalized eigenvalue problem (where x is an unknown nonzero vector) can be calculated as the ratio of the diagonal elements of S to those of T. I am struggling with the QZ decomposition of two singular matrices. Introduction. MATRIX SCHUR FORM Usual schur form: [U,T] = schur(A) produces a Schur matrix T and a unitary matrix U so that A = U*T*U' and U'*U = eye(U).By itself, schur(A) returns T.If A is complex, the Complex Schur Form is returned in matrix T. Functions to compute generalized eigenvalues and eigenvectors, the generalized Schur decomposition and the generalized Singular Value Decomposition of a matrix pair, using Lapack routines. : 375. Microprocessing and Microprogramming 38 :1-5, 335-342. The Generalized Schur Decomposition and the rank-$R$ set of real $I\times J\times 2$ arrays Classiï¬cation and normal forms of functions Schur â¦ This MATLAB function returns the Schur matrix T. The eigenvalues, which in this case are 1, 2, and 3, are on the diagonal.The fact that the off-diagonal elements are so large indicates that this matrix has poorly conditioned eigenvalues; small changes in the matrix elements produce relatively large changes in â¦ The generalized Schur (QZ) decomposition failed. Robust software with error bounds for computing the generalized Schur decomposition of an arbitrary matrix pencil A B (regular or singular) is presented. It allows one to write an arbitrary complex matrix as unitarily equivalent to an upper triangular matrix whose diagonal elements are the eigenvalues of the original matrix. alized) Schur form may consist of complex matrices. The decomposition functions are mainly based Fortran subroutines in complex*16 and double precision of LAPACK library (version 3.4.2. or later). Pontryagin space operator valued generalized Schur functions and generalized Nevanlinna functions are investigated by using discrete-time systems, or operator colligations, and state space realizations. This paper considers the computation of a few eigenvalue-eigenvector pairs (eigenpairs) of eigenvalue problems of the form Ax= Mx, where the matrices Aand SchurDecomposition[{m, a}] gives the generalized Schur decomposition of m with respect to a. Calculate Generalized Eigenvalues, the Generalized Schur Decomposition and the Generalized Singular Value Decomposition of a Matrix Pair with Lapack. Hello jpfeifer, My model work fine when i choose a certain parameter value. Numerical computation of Generalized Complex Schur decomposition can be performed by calling zgges() LAPACK function. Key words. ... We show how the classical QR algorithm can be extended to provide a stable algorithm for computing this generalized decomposition. In geigen: Calculate Generalized Eigenvalues, the Generalized Schur Decomposition and the Generalized Singular Value Decomposition of a Matrix Pair with Lapack. $\endgroup$ â Anton Menshov Oct 7 '19 at 7:01 add a comment | 0 Schur form is preferable from a computational point of view.1 This fact has led to the development of readily available state-of-the-art algorithms for the calculation and manipulation of the generalized Schur â¦ This MATLAB function returns the Schur matrix T. The eigenvalues, which in this case are 1, 2, and 3, are on the diagonal.The fact that the off-diagonal elements are so large indicates that this matrix has poorly conditioned eigenvalues; small changes in the matrix elements produce relatively large changes in â¦ Reorders the generalized Schur decomposition of a pair of matrices (A,B) so that one diagonal block of (A,B) moves to another row index. Description. The decomposition is a generalization of the Schur canonical form of A â Î»I to matrix pencils and reveals the Kronecker structure of a singular pencil.